Quick answer

Kumala is a village in Kathua Tehsil of Kathua district in Jammu and Kashmir. Its Census location code is 001810.

About Kumala village record

Kumala is listed under Kathua Tehsil in Kathua district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 75, 15 households, area 66 hectares, PIN code 184104.
